Study of Variation in Quadriceps Angle in Healthy Individuals

Journal Title: Scholars Journal of Applied Medical Sciences - Year 2018, Vol 6, Issue 6

Abstract

Abstract: Quadriceps angle is defined as the angle formed by the vector for the combined pull of the quadriceps f muscle and the patellar tendon. The aim of the study was to analyse the effect of age and gender on quadriceps angle. A cross-sectional study was conducted in 600 healthy individuals. Subjects with any present or past history of trauma, degenerative disorders, structural deformity, inflammatory condition of bilateral lower extremities and spine were excluded. Quadriceps angle was measured using goniometric method in supine lying position bilaterally. Of the 600 participants, 300 were males and 300 females. There was a statistically significant negative correlation (r = -0.232, p = 0.000) between age and right limb quadriceps angle. Also, it was observed that women have greater value quadriceps angle than men in both right (p = 0.000) and left limb (p = 0.000). The present study showed that there was an inverse relationship between age and quadriceps angle. The gender difference in quadriceps angle was statistically significant with greater quadriceps angle in women than men. Evaluation of quadriceps angle is an essential component to assess the knee function and alignment.
